Theological Interpretations of Divine Justice

Examining god on lucifer through justice reveals debates about punishment, mercy, and moral balance. Thinkers weigh whether Lucifer's fall reflects necessary discipline or a tragic misuse of freedom.

Some frameworks highlight divine restraint, arguing that true justice requires limits on rebellion without immediate annihilation. This view underscores patience, giving space for accountability and possible reconciliation.

Others emphasize that divine justice ultimately serves restoration rather than retribution alone. Within this lens, Lucifer’s role becomes a catalyst for deeper exploration of grace, responsibility, and the cost of moral autonomy.

Mythological Roots and Symbolic Language

Ancient myths shape how god on lucifer is imagined across cultures and texts. Symbols of light, exile, and ambition express fears and hopes about power that defies established order.

The Lucifer figure often embodies boundary-crossing desire, turning divine gift into a claim of equality. Stories highlight how pride, envy, and insight intertwine, complicating simple labels of hero or villain.

Modern readers must separate symbolic narrative from rigid doctrines, recognizing myth as a language for inner conflict and social tension. This awareness enriches dialogue without reducing either figure to caricature.

How does divine justice apply when Lucifer questions God's authority?

Many traditions view this as a test of justice that affirms moral accountability while highlighting divine patience. The focus is on responsible use of freedom rather than mere defiance.

Can Lucifer’s rebellion be understood as a legitimate exercise of free will?

Yes, within frameworks that value autonomy, Lucifer’s choice demonstrates free will, though often with severe consequences. The narrative explores limits when freedom opposes relational trust.

What distinguishes theological analysis of Lucifer from mythological interpretation?

Theological analysis centers on doctrine, scripture, and communal teaching, whereas mythological interpretation focuses on symbols, archetypes, and cultural storytelling. Both inform but differ in scope and method.

Why do modern adaptations sometimes portray Lucifer more sympathetically than traditional doctrine?

Contemporary culture often emphasizes personal agency, questioning rigid hierarchies. These adaptations respond to current values while prompting reconsideration of justice, mercy, and the cost of rebellion.
